Your review is Submitted Successfully. ×
2.8

Summary

Franchise India Brands Ltd
atul mishra@atulmishra14
Feb 12, 2020 09:53 PM, 5233 Views
Franchise india fraud company

Franchise india a biggest fraud company in India, doing frauds with investor brands and employee also..

(0)
Please fill in a comment to justify your rating for this review.
Post

Recommended Top Articles

Question & Answer